Ray Bellavance

Job Titles:
  • Vice President of Global Sales and Marketing
Ray joined MicroCare in 2021 with nearly 30 years of experience selling industrial chemicals and tools, including MicroCare products, in his prior role at Jensen Tool & Supply (now owned by Test Equity). Ray, a process driven and fact-based decision maker, held top-level management positions in the industrial, electronics and construction industries. He started his career as a salesperson for Dexter Corporation and progressively advanced into roles at Stanley Black & Decker, Danaher Tool Group, Craftsman and as President at FEIN Power Tools. Ray holds a bachelor's degree in psychology from the University of Massachusetts. As Vice President of Global Sales and Marketing, Ray Bellavance leverages decades of experience to help lead the MicroCare team in promoting our growing lineup of brands and maximizing our sales and marketing resources across the globe.

Scott Wells

Job Titles:
  • General Manager
MicroCare made theirs first European sale in 1990. Today, MicroCare UK Ltd provides a significant contribution to the overall achievements of MicroCare, LLC. The credit for that success goes to Scott Wells, MicroCare UK Ltd General Manager. Scott has built an impressive team. He supervises a network of distributors which stretches across three continents (EMEA). He has multiple, highly capable sales people and a strong logistics team behind him, complete with a warehouse and logisitics centre based in Leeds, UK. It's a complex, high-pressure job that Scott does very well. Scott started his career as a pricing analyst for Maplin Electronics, a high street retailer of electronic consummables and components. A subsequent move to Farnell introduced him to the world of product management where he gained a significant understanding of the soldering and electro chemical sectors. Scott migrated to an export sales management position at PACE follwed by a move to HK Wentworth, Electrolube. Finally, he moved to MicroCare in 2007.

Tom Tattersall - CEO

Job Titles:
  • Chief Executive Officer
  • the Humble and Proud CEO
  • the New Business Development Manager Back
When Tom Tattersall joined MicroCare as the New Business Development Manager back in 1997 it was a small family-owned company. It consisted of one location and a handful of employees. Today the company is a foundation business and part of the portfolio of Heartwood Partners. It is much bigger and growing fast. As Chief Executive Officer, Tom now oversees five production facilities, four logistics centers, a distribution network spanning 47 countries and nearly 150 employees across the globe. He is responsible for all business operations including business development and strategic planning.
